Yassine Kechta leaving Le Havre?
Yassine Kechta, a 23-year-old Moroccan midfielder, is in his last contract year with Le Havre. Due to the financial difficulties of his current club, which narrowly avoided relegation last season, they might be forced to sell him. His market value is estimated at five million. Kechta is seeking a new challenge and is considered a priority target by Genk, who have been following him for a while. Internal approvals for the transfer are reportedly in place, and significant progress has been made in negotiations. The deal could be finalized soon.
KRC Genk is pushing hard to acquire Yassine Kechta from Le Havre. The 23-year-old Moroccan French midfielder is considered a priority for Genk. He has been scouted multiple times and internal profiles have approved him. Initial contacts have been made according to TeamFootball. Kechta has a market value of 5 million euros and is under contract until 2026. While he wants to advance his career, he remains attached to Le Havre and is considering their new project with investors.
